| Job Summary |
We are seeking a motivated scientist with strong training in molecular biology, biochemistry, or cell biology. The successful candidate will contribute to ongoing research projects while also supporting laboratory operations in a collaborative and intellectually engaging research environment.
We are looking for individuals who are curious, rigorous, and collaborative. Members of the Shukla Lab are encouraged to think critically about experiments, engage in scientific discussion, and contribute ideas that help shape ongoing research. Early members of the lab will play an important role in helping establish experimental platforms and building a collaborative scientific environment.
Well suited for individuals seeking additional research experience before pursuing graduate or professional training. |

| Essential Duties and Responsibilities |
- Perform molecular biology experiments, including cloning, protein expression, and protein purification.
- Conduct biochemical and biophysical assays under the guidance of the PI and other lab members.
- Maintain accurate experimental records and assist with data analysis.
- Assist with laboratory organization, including maintaining reagent stocks, ordering supplies, and coordinating shared resources.
- Support laboratory safety compliance and help establish standard operating procedures.
- Provide technical support to trainees and contribute to maintaining a collaborative and inclusive lab environment.
